Using Benzodiazepines Safely and Legally in Australia
Benzodiazepines are a class of medications that are prescribed to alleviate anxiety, insomnia, and seizures. They work by slowing down activity in the central nervous system. While they can be effective for short-term use, it's essential to use them responsibly as they have the potential for addiction. In Australia, benzodiazepines are a Schedule 4 drug, meaning they can only be obtained with a prescription from a registered medical doctor.
It's vital to stick with your doctor's instructions carefully and never exceed the prescribed amount. If you're feeling any complications, it's essential to contact your doctor immediately. Abruptly stopping benzodiazepines can lead to withdrawal symptoms which can be unpleasant.
Furthermore, it's important to be aware that benzodiazepines can interact with other substances, so always let know your doctor about all the drugs you are currently taking. Remember that benzodiazepines are not a long-term solution for mental health conditions. If you're struggling with anxiety, insomnia, or other mental health difficulties, it's important to seek support from a qualified healthcare provider.
